South India Tour 05

 

THE EXOTIC SOUTH
(14 Nights & 15 Days)

 

MUMBAI -> | GOA -> | BELGAUM -> | BADAMI -> | AIHOLE -> | PATTADAKAL -> | HOSPET -> | HASSAN -> | MADIKERI -> | MYSORE -> | SRIRANGAPATNAM - BANGALORE

 

Day 01 : Arrive Mumbai 
Arrive Mumbai, meet assist at the airport and transfer to hotel. Night stay in Mumbai.

 

Day 02 : Mumbai
After breakfast proceed for half day tour of Mumbai covering Gateway of India - The stone archway designed by Wittett in the 16th century Gujarati style, Prince of Whales Museum , Chowpatty Beach, Dhobhi Ghat, Marine Drive. Night stay in Bombay.

 

Day 03 : Mumbai - Goa ( By flight )
Morning transfer to airport for flight to Goa. On arrival transfer to hotel. Day at leisure. Night stay in Goa.

 

Day 04 : Goa
After breakfast, proceed on a half day sightseeing tour of Goa, visiting Miramar Beach, Basilica of Bom Jesus and the city of Panjim-bustling with shops and tourists. The afternoon is at leisure to relax on the beach. Night stay in Goa.

 

Day 05 : Goa
Day at leisure. Laze on the beach, go for swim, explore the shops for cashewnuts. Night stay in Goa.

 

Day 06 : Goa - Belgaum - Badami (By road, 275 kms 6 hrs)
After breakfast drive to Badami enroute visiting Belgaum - a total picture of contrasts. On one side is the old town area and modern on other, in the heart of Belgaum is the Fort. Inside it are most famous Kamala Basti, the Jain Temple & the Jama Masjid. The Kapileshwar Temple, the Ananthashayana. Night stay in Badami.

 

Day 07 : Badami
Rock-cut cave Temples, Gateways, Forts, Inscriptions, Sculptures that seem to come alive before your eyes. Badami has to be seen to be believed. Climb a flight of steps to reach the ancient caves - all hewn out of sand stone on the precipice of a hill. Also a must see are Bhutanatha temples that lend their names to the lake just beneath the cave temples. Take a dip in this green tranquil river. It is said to have the healing properties. Badami also has the eighteen inscriptions ranging from 06th to 09th century. Night stay in Badami.

 

Day 08 : Badami - Aihole - Pattadakal - Hospet ( By road )
After breakfast drive to Hospet enroute visiting Aihole and Pattadakal, and for that nothing can be said as everything is self explanatory. Aihole which is famous as the "cradle of the Indian Architecture". Also visit Pattadakal - Situated on the left bank of the Malaprabha river, a world heritage centre, has 10 major temples representing early Chalukyan architecture, later continue towards Hospet. Night stay in Hospet.

 

Day 09 : Hospet
Morning explore the beautiful world of Hospet. The touristic importance of this lies in its proximity to Hampi, the site of the Medieval Vijaynagar Empire, (13 kms) is the most evocative of all the ruins in Karnataka. Night stay in Hospet.

 

Day 10 : Hospet - Hassan ( By road )
After a relaxed breakfast drive to Hassan. Later excursion to Belur & Halebid, a beautiful example of Hoysala architecture. Famous of them is The Chennakesava Temple : which took 103 years to complete. The temples of Halebid bear mute testimony to the rich, cultural heritage of Karnataka. Night stay in Hassan.

 

Day 11 : Hassan - Shravanbelagola - Hassan
Morning visit Shravanbelgola. 51 kms south - east of Hassan, one of most important Jain Pilgrim centers. Here is the 17m high monolith of Lord Bahubali - the world’s tallest monolithic statue. Rest of the day you will remain free to explore the surroundings. Night stay in Hassan.

 

Day 12 : Hassan - Madikeri ( By road )
After breakfast drive to Madikeri, a place which is called as the "Scotland Of India". In Madikeri visit Madikeri Fort , Abbey Falls , Nisargadhama - Known for its calm, serene beauty, this place is an ideal picnic spot visited by hundreds of tourists throughout the year. Night stay in Madikeri.

 

Day 13 : Madikeri - Mysore ( By road )
Morning drive to Mysore and transfer to hotel. Later visit :Mysore Palace, Chamundi hills - Towering over the city, these hills are 13 kms away from Mysore. Halfway up is the Nandi bull, a 4.8m monolith. Brindavan Gardens - A site to be loved. The musical fountains & colourful lights transform this place into a fairy land. Night stay in Mysore.

 

Day 14 : Mysore
After breakfast visit Sri Jayachamarajendra Art Gallery - Housed in the Jag Mohan Palace, the gallery has a collection of exquisite paintings. In the afternoon visit Somnathpur. It is a little village where you can see the famous 13th century temple well known for its great architectural beauty. The star shaped temple with three shrines is the latest & well preserved heritage of Hoysala architecture. Night stay in Mysore.

 

Day 15 : Mysore - Srirangapatnam - Bangalore - Departure
Morning drive to Bangalore enroute visiting Srirangapatnam, capital of the warrior - King Hyder Ali & his son Tipu Sultan, has magnificent monuments that are well worth a visit. Continue drive to Bangalore and transfer to airport for onward flight.
